It is influenced by a variety of factors, including the type of waste recycling machine, the nature of the waste, and the machine&#8217;s design and build &#8211; quality.<\/p>\n<h4>Type of Recycling Machine<\/h4>\n<p>There are numerous types of waste recycling machines, each designed to process different types of waste. For example, a paper recycling machine, which is mainly used to break down paper into pulp, has a different maximum weight capacity compared to a metal recycling machine. Paper recycling machines often have a relatively lower maximum weight capacity because paper is light and voluminous. These machines are typically designed to handle large volumes of low &#8211; density waste. On the other hand, metal recycling machines are built to handle much heavier materials. They need to be able to withstand the high weight and impact of large metal pieces, such as old car parts or industrial metal scraps. As a result, metal recycling machines generally have a much higher maximum weight capacity compared to paper recycling machines.<\/p>\n<p>Another type is the plastic recycling machine. Plastic comes in different forms, from thin plastic films to thick plastic pipes. Plastic recycling machines are engineered to deal with a wide range of plastic densities. However, due to the nature of plastic, which can often be sticky and clog the machine&#8217;s internal components, the maximum weight they can handle may be affected by factors such as the type of plastic and the frequency of cleaning and maintenance.<\/p>\n<h4>Nature of the Waste<\/h4>\n<p>The characteristics of the waste itself play a significant role in determining the maximum weight a recycling machine can handle. If the waste is homogeneous, such as a batch of aluminum cans all of the same size and shape, the recycling machine can typically handle a higher weight. Homogeneous waste flows more easily through the machine and is less likely to cause jams or blockages.<\/p>\n<p>In contrast, heterogeneous waste, which consists of a mixture of different materials, shapes, and sizes, poses more challenges for the recycling machine. For example, a mix of plastic bottles, cardboard boxes, and metal scraps requires more complex sorting and processing. The machine has to deal with different densities and physical properties at the same time, which can limit the maximum weight it can handle. Additionally, if the waste contains a lot of contaminants, such as dirt, grease, or non &#8211; recyclable materials, it can also reduce the machine&#8217;s capacity as the contaminants may damage the machine or reduce its efficiency.<\/p>\n<h4>Machine Design and Build &#8211; Quality<\/h4>\n<p>The design and build &#8211; quality of the recycling machine are also key factors. A well &#8211; designed machine with a solid structure and high &#8211; quality components can handle a larger amount of waste. The size of the feeding hopper, the power of the motors, and the strength of the conveyor belts all contribute to the machine&#8217;s maximum weight capacity.<\/p>\n<p>For instance, a machine with a large feeding hopper can accept a greater volume of waste at once, allowing it to process more weight in a shorter period. Powerful motors are essential for driving the various mechanisms in the recycling machine, such as shredders, crushers, and separators. If the motors are not strong enough, they may overheat or break down when trying to process a large amount of waste. Similarly, sturdy conveyor belts are necessary to transport the waste through the machine. Weak or poorly &#8211; constructed conveyor belts may buckle or tear under the weight of the waste, reducing the machine&#8217;s capacity.<\/p>\n<h3>Different Weight Capacities in the Market<\/h3>\n<p>In the waste recycling machine market, there is a wide range of maximum weight capacities to meet the diverse needs of different customers.<\/p>\n<h4>Small &#8211; Scale Recycling Machines<\/h4>\n<p>Small &#8211; scale recycling machines are often used by small businesses, local communities, or for domestic applications. These machines typically have a lower maximum weight capacity, usually ranging from a few kilograms to a few hundred kilograms per hour. For example, a small &#8211; scale paper recycling machine for a local print shop might be able to process 50 &#8211; 100 kilograms of paper waste per hour. These machines are designed for relatively low &#8211; volume waste processing and are more affordable and easier to operate.<\/p>\n<h4>Medium &#8211; Scale Recycling Machines<\/h4>\n<p>Medium &#8211; scale recycling machines are suitable for medium &#8211; sized businesses, recycling centers, or some municipality waste management facilities. Their maximum weight capacity can range from a few hundred kilograms to a few tons per hour. A medium &#8211; scale plastic recycling machine, for example, might be able to handle 500 kilograms to 2 tons of plastic waste per hour. These machines offer a good balance between capacity and cost, and they usually come with more advanced features and better build &#8211; quality compared to small &#8211; scale machines.<\/p>\n<h4>Large &#8211; Scale Recycling Machines<\/h4>\n<p>Large &#8211; scale recycling machines are used by large industrial enterprises, major waste management companies, and large &#8211; scale recycling plants. These machines are designed to handle extremely high volumes of waste, with a maximum weight capacity that can exceed several tons per hour. A large &#8211; scale metal recycling machine in an industrial scrap yard might be able to process 10 &#8211; 50 tons of metal waste per hour. These machines are often highly automated, with advanced sorting and processing technologies, and they require significant investment in terms of purchase, installation, and maintenance.<\/p>\n<h3>Determining the Right Machine for Your Needs<\/h3>\n<p>When considering purchasing a waste recycling machine, it is essential to determine the appropriate maximum weight capacity for your specific requirements. Here are some steps to help you make the right decision.<\/p>\n<h4>Assess Your Waste Volume<\/h4>\n<p>First, you need to accurately assess the volume of waste you generate. This can be done by analyzing your historical waste data, if available. For businesses, this may involve looking at monthly or quarterly waste reports. If you are a municipality, you can gather data from different collection points. Understanding the average and peak waste volumes will give you a clear idea of the minimum weight capacity your recycling machine should have.<\/p>\n<h4>Consider Future Growth<\/h4>\n<p>It is also important to consider future growth when choosing a recycling machine. If your business is expanding, or if the population in your municipality is growing, the volume of waste you generate is likely to increase. Choosing a machine with a slightly higher maximum weight capacity than your current needs can save you from having to replace the machine in the near future.<\/p>\n<h4>Evaluate Your Budget<\/h4>\n<p>Your budget is another crucial factor. Generally, machines with higher maximum weight capacities are more expensive. You need to balance your need for a high &#8211; capacity machine with your financial resources. It may be possible to find a machine that offers a good compromise between capacity and cost, or you may need to consider financing options if you require a large &#8211; scale machine.<\/p>\n<h3>Conclusion<\/h3>\n<p>In summary, the maximum weight of waste that a waste recycling machine can handle is a complex issue influenced by multiple factors.
